Responsibilities

  • Technical Support Engineer dealing with a range of heating solutions such as boilers, heat tanks and renewable heat pumps.
  • Acting as first line technical support to merchants, contractors, installers and housing associations for all queries relating to central heating products.
  • Offering technical support to internal stakeholders.
  • Fielding inbound telephone queries and providing appropriate solutions.
  • Carrying out product training and familiarisation for both colleagues and customers.
  • Prompt and accurate reporting to the Customer Care Manager.
  • Ensuring compliance with health and safety procedures.

Qualifications

  • Must have experience within the plumbing, heating and renewables sector.
  • Knowledge specifically in renewables, heat pumps and air sourced heat pumps is ideal, however open to other related fields.
  • May be open to one of the following or closely related: engineer, installer, technical support, technical engineers, technical advisors.
  • Positive telephone manner with the ability to resolve customer queries in a professional manner.
  • IT literate (Microsoft Office).
  • Excellent communication skills both written and verbal.
  • Stable career history.
